Can a user change their default time range?

Can a user change their default search time range to be, let's say, five minutes and not use our default of 60 minutes?

Sure you can, just add something like:

dispatch.earliest_time = -15m
dispatch.latest_time = now

to the ui-prefs.conf on system/local to make it global or in /etc/users///ui-prefs.conf

[search]
dispatch.earliest_time = -15m
dispatch.latest_time = now
